SB 389 Oklahoma Senate · 2026 Regular Session

Workers' compensation; granting Attorney General concurrent authority with the Oklahoma Workers' Compensation Commission to investigate and enforce certain violations; authorizing certain inspections. Emergency.

SB 389 allows Oklahoma's Attorney General to investigate and enforce workers' compensation insurance requirements alongside the Oklahoma Workers' Compensation Commission. It directly affects employers who fail to secure required workers' compensation coverage, potentially facing misdemeanor charges and fines up to $10,000. The bill amends existing law to establish this concurrent enforcement authority, updating procedures for investigations and penalties. The law takes effect immediately due to an emergency declaration.
